marg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to; doesn't seem to be centering
tables in a webpage I'm working on, in IE. It does so in Opera, but
not in IE. Any ideas as to why? Or better yet, what I can do to fix
it?

In Mozilla it is not centered as well. Do you have the container content
centered? That makes the margin left and right be the same. Else it is
often aligned left.
